How do you ask for directions? What questions should you ask a potential babysitter? How do you explain your allergies to a healthcare professional? This handy reference is your guide to surviving and thriving in the United States, whether as a visitor or as a long-term resident. Hundreds of ready-to-use English phrases will help you converse with people you meet, speak with business owners and their employees, and become engaged in U.S. society. Inside find examples of Perfect Phrases for . . .
. . . the doctor: Are there any side effects with this medication?
. . . the library: Do you have audiobooks?
. . . the service station: My insurance company wants the estimate in writing.
. . . the bank: I'd like to talk to someone about a home equity loan.
. . . the dentist: This is where it hurts.

Active Learning Advice:
Don’t Wait to Use Your English!
Don’t wait for that special future time when you expect to be able to communicate in English error free. Unless you practice, that moment will never come. Take your English language skills, though limited, and use them. Begin every encounter with Hello,
Hi,
Nice to meet you,
or Glad to see you again.
At each parting say, Good-bye,
So long,
Hope to see you again,
or I’m sure we’ll talk again soon.
